yeah ... it's a balancing act to win pretty much.

you must balance between earth and space, and techs.

you can technically with without investing anything in military only if you start with EU or USA. as their military is already pretty strong, and no other faction can match them to begin with.

just make sure you have enemies enabled, as you will sometimes get events which give +0.1 militech. and that's almost better than a whole year full investment in military.

Science is super important, the more you have as early as possible, the faster you can reach the techs to actually beat aliens.

and for that you need to make as many Orbital base around earth as possible.

and have Skunk work on every single station you make on other planets.

you can reach 100-150% more faction project speed with that alone. so it's not to be frowned upon.

Try to always control 1 global tech to steer towards either earth to orbit defense, or good ship tech, and then just pump everything in your faction tech.

Other faction will eventually unlock other useful stuff, like most expedition missions, orbital/hab t2 and such. just make sure you steer techs when needed.

if you really need something done, drop all points into 2 global tech. stop your faction techs. and progress things faster when needed.

and for space supremacy its all about numbers. monitor is on top of almost anything provided they have a good PD and good missiles, but you need several (10+) to be able to defend earth.

if you get that around earth, it's just a matter of time before you actually get tech far enough to go kill aliens i suppose.
